This wide-ranging interdisciplinary book examines acts of union and disunion in local, national and international nineteenth century settings, in Britain, Europe and the United States. It explores themes in relation to political leadership, trade unions, emancipation, religion and law.

This volume examines the nineteenth century not only through episodes, institutions, sites and representations concerned with union, concord and bonds of sympathy, but also through moments of secession, separation, discord and disjunction. Its lens extends from the local and regional, through to national and international settings in Britain, Europe and the United States. The contributors come from the fields of cultural history, literary studies, American studies and legal history.
